# Compana Pet Brands

> Compana Pet Brands is a privately held, Carlyle-backed manufacturer and marketer of pet care, nutrition, wellness and cleanup products. The Chesterfield, Missouri company operates more than 20 brands across dogs and cats, small animals, companion birds, backyard poultry and horses, selling through retail, ecommerce and direct-to-consumer channels. Its distinction is the breadth of species and use cases under one portfolio, assembled through organic growth and a sustained acquisition strategy.

## Products & services

- **Dog and cat care portfolio** — Treats, food toppers, supplements, flea and tick products, grooming, hygiene, toys, dental care and waste cleanup under brands including Fruitables, Dinovite, Vet's Best, Natural Care, Bullymake, Doggie Dailies, Nutri-Vet, Simple Solution and OUT! Petcare.
- **Small-animal nutrition and care** — Food, hay, supplements, enrichment and care products for rabbits, guinea pigs, hamsters, gerbils, chinchillas and other small pets, led by Oxbow, Manna Pro and Small World.
- **Backyard poultry products** — Complete feeds, insect treats, supplements and hard goods for backyard flocks through Manna Pro and Flock Party.
- **Equine care and nutrition** — Feed, supplements, treats, wound care and grooming products through Manna Pro, Calf Manna and Corona.
- **Companion-bird nutrition** — Pelleted diets and treats for companion birds, select small mammals and zoological animals through ZuPreem.
- **Bullymake subscription** — A direct-to-consumer monthly box of durable toys and treats designed for heavy-chewing dogs.
- **Dinovite Dental Chews** — Firm-texture dog dental chews using a clinically studied postbiotic to support the oral microbiome and help address bad breath.

## Achievements

- Built a portfolio of more than 20 pet-care and nutrition brands across five animal categories.
- Completed 15 acquisitions over the decade leading into 2023, with acquisitions accounting for nearly half of growth according to former CEO John Howe.
- Grew reported revenue more than eightfold over 15 years and above $600 million by early 2023, according to company statements.
- Became the largest food manufacturer in the small-animal category after acquiring Oxbow Animal Health, according to the company's 2022 rebrand announcement.
- Expanded into premium companion-bird nutrition through the acquisition of ZuPreem, then sold in more than 5,000 U.S. pet stores.
- Opened a consolidated St. Louis-area headquarters in 2025.
